Corinthians training: Dorival sharpens attack as Felipe Longo returns

Corinthians returned to training on Thursday morning, with goalkeeper Felipe Longo back from an elbow ligament issue. He is expected to start at Fluminense next week at the Maracanã, with Hugo Souza unavailable due to the FIFA window.
According to Globo.com, Dorival Júnior split the session into phases, opening with transition drills featuring three against two and four against two to rehearse counter-attacks.
The squad then worked on offensive construction aligned to the staff’s tactical concepts. Improving chance creation has been a recurring focus in recent weeks and Dorival is seeking solutions.
The morning ended with a small-sided game. No starters or reserves have been confirmed for next Wednesday’s match against Fluminense, with the line-up to be set early next week.
International call-ups ruled out Hugo Souza, Memphis Depay, André Carrillo and Gui Negão, the latter with Brazil Under-20. Forward Kaio César and full-back Hugo remain in the medical department.
Training resumes on Friday morning at CT Joaquim Grava. In the coming weeks, beyond Brasileirão fixtures, Corinthians open their Conmebol Libertadores campaign against Platense of Argentina and begin the Copa do Brasil against Barra of Santa Catarina.
